Keswick Film Festival

28th February to 3rd March. Starting on the last day of February, the Keswick Film Festival is an early highlight on the annual events in the Lake District. Expect a combination of old classic blockbusters alongside masterpieces by up and coming directors. Then there’s the now prestigious Osprey Short Films Awards.

Cumbria Life Home & Garden Show

15th to 17th March. Taking place at the Rheged Centre in Penrith, the event is likely to attract 100’s of visitors to the Lake District in March 2019. While staying in Cumbria, it will give you the chance to learn new skills and embrace fresh ideas.
